In the major event “Tribute to Morricone Film History” a 40-piece orchestra and 100 choristers perform the most beautiful soundtracks in film history. The show traces the highlights of the Maestro’s career: from his early collaborations with Sergio Leone to the music he created for Hollywood, which consecrated the Italian composer as a world icon and awarded him a star on the Walk Of Fame. In addition to a large orchestra, the more than 100 choristers of the Ensemble Vocale Ambrosiano, I Musici Cantori di Milano, and the Carducci Choir directed by Mauro Penacca will also be on stage.
The show will not only be a way to listen to the Maestro’s music live, but also – through video content – to recall the historical path of his creations and all the prestigious collaborations Morricone has done with the biggest names in international cinema.
